Raleigh Man Charged in Durham Stabbing Death


e-mail print friendly

A Raleigh man was arrested Friday and charged in the death of a man whose body was found behind Bethesda Elementary School in October, police said.

Robert Leon Washington, 30, of Suburban Drive, was arrested Friday morning by Raleigh and Durham officers on Waterford Park Lane in Raleigh. He was charged with murder and was being held in the Durham County Jail without bond.

Cornelius Wayne Johnson, 26, of Raleigh, was found stabbed to death on Oct. 19 by a landscaping crew in some woods between Bethesda Elementary and houses off Glenco Road.

Johnson had been reported missing to the Raleigh Police Department on Sept. 22.

Police said Washington and Johnson were acquaintances.
